The GlueX experiment at Jefferson Lab has collected a world-leading set of photoproduction data, which is being used to address many outstanding problems in hadronic physics. I will present the status of the search for hybrid mesons with GlueX data, including recent results on polarization observables and partial wave analyses. I will also discuss a selection of other recent results, including new measurements of charmonium production near-thresholds which have implications for the study of nucleon structure and the search for the photoproduction of heavy pentaquark states.
